6
Q

What is systematic sampling?

A

A ,ethod where the sample is chosen at a regular agreed interval

7
Q

What is random sampling?

A

A method where is sample is chosen by a randomly generated list of numbers

9
Q

What is pragmatic sampling?

A

A method which chooses sampling sites for external fators suchas where the location is unsafe, inaccessible or where the permission has been denied. Makes results less reliable
